Comprehending Drug Interactions and Potential Side Effects
When administering multiple medications, it's crucial here to consider the potential for drug interactions. These occur when one medication influences the way another medication operates. Such interactions can lead to enhanced or reduced effects, potentially producing negative outcomes. Additionally, it's important to be aware of potential side effects that can occur from interacting different medications. Carefully reviewing medication information and consulting a healthcare professional can help minimize the risk of adverse outcomes.

The Role of Medications in Chronic Disease Management
Chronic diseases pose significant challenges for individuals and healthcare systems worldwide. Effective management of these disorders often depends on a combination of lifestyle modifications and medical interventions. Among these, medications play a vital role in managing symptoms, preventing complications, and improving the overall quality of life for patients.
Medications work by interacting with specific pathways involved in the disease process. They can decrease inflammation, suppress immune responses, or modify hormonal activity. By relieving these underlying mechanisms, medications can assist individuals achieve better disease control and reduce the risk of adverse outcomes.

Navigating Prescription Costs: Strategies for Affordability
Rising prescription drug costs can pose a significant challenge to patient well-being. Thankfully, there are several strategies you can employ to mitigate these expenses and ensure access to essential medications. First, explore generic alternatives whenever possible. Generics often offer the same benefits as brand-name drugs at a fraction of the cost. Additionally, discuss openly with your healthcare provider about your financial situation. They may be able to recommend less expensive options or consider patient assistance programs offered by pharmaceutical companies.
Moreover, joining a prescription drug discount program can offer substantial savings on your prescriptions. These programs often secure lower prices with pharmacies, passing the reductions onto members.
Finally, remember to exploit your health insurance benefits fully. Understand your coverage parameters and ask about co-pay assistance programs or prescription drug formulary options that may reduce your out-of-pocket expenses.
By implementing these strategies, you can effectively control prescription costs and prioritize your health without compromising your financial well-being.
From Lab to Patient: The Journey of a New Medication
A groundbreaking drug discovery starts within the walls of a research laboratory. Scientists diligently work to identify and understand biological pathways that contribute to disease. Through rigorous testing, they identify promising compounds with the potential to treat conditions.
These early discoveries are carefully evaluated before moving into preclinical research in animal models. These experiments help to assess the potential of the new therapy and provide valuable information about its mechanism.
If preclinical outcomes are positive, the compound enters into clinical research, a multi-phase process involving patient participants. Each phase assesses different aspects of the treatment's efficacy.
The journey from lab to patient is a long and complex one, requiring years of research, development, and evaluation. Regulatory authorities regulate the entire process to ensure the quality of new treatments. Only when a drug has successfully completed all necessary studies and met stringent requirements can it be made accessible to patients.
